What is Adult ADD?
Adult ADD, frequently described within the more comprehensive classification of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D), is identified by persistent problems with attention, impulsiveness, and in some cases hyperactivity. Unlike kids, adults may present with more subtle symptoms, such as problem concentrating, persistent poor organization, and difficulties in preserving relationships.

Taking an Adult ADD test typically includes numerous essential steps, as described below:
1. Self-Assessment Questionnaire
Before diving into expert assessments, many individuals begin with self-assessment surveys. These self-reported tools can assist determine symptoms and behaviors that line up with ADD.
2. Professional Evaluation
Consulting a certified specialist-- such as a psychologist or psychiatrist-- permits a comprehensive examination. The professional might utilize standard diagnostic tools such as:
Assessment ToolDescriptionAdult ADHD Clinical ScaleA questionnaire examining symptoms and influence on every day life.Brown Attention-Deficit Disorder ScalesExamines specific areas such as organization, attention, and self-regulation.Conners Adult ADHD Rating ScalesEvaluates symptoms and behaviors related to ADHD in adults.3. Interview and History Review
Experts frequently perform structured interviews. This step may consist of an evaluation of an individual's case history, family background, and instructional experiences to identify the determination of symptoms.
4. Additional Testing
In some cases, cognitive tests may be administered to examine attention span, working memory, and executive function skills.

Who should take the Adult ADD test?
People experiencing consistent difficulties related to attention, company, or impulsivity may benefit from taking the Adult ADD test.
2. Is ADD the like ADHD?
ADD is thought about an outdated term, with ADHD being the more incorporating term. ADHD includes symptoms of hyperactivity, while ADD usually relates to inattention without the hyperactivity element.
3. Can adults establish ADD later on in life?
ADD symptoms can emerge in their adult years, particularly following considerable stress factors such as task loss, trauma, or major life changes.
4. How precise are self-assessment surveys?
While self-assessments can supply insights and timely people to seek professional help, they are not definitive. A professional evaluation is essential for a precise medical diagnosis.
